When I’m weary and feeling small, and tears are in my eyes, I dry them all by hopping up to Dominic’s Santos for a bowl of pasta with vodka sauce. My husband and I discovered this small gem in Fairview Park about a year ago when we had a memorable meal of lemony chicken Francese and saucy chicken Parmesan, both of which are two of the best Italian dishes you’ll find on the West side. But the pasta with vodka sauce, a creamy pasta dish with ground Italian sausage, can change your life. It is comfort food to the nth power. Try it and experience a personal renaissance. We’ve tried some other things, like pizza, subs and manicotti, all of which were delicious, but the three aforementioned dishes are our go-to meals when we dine here. Skip the appetizers, as they are unremarkable. Entrees here come with your choice of a house salad or wedding soup. The salad is usually fresh and crisp with a generous heap of shredded cheese and garbanzo beans. The house Italian dressing is a tangy red wine vinaigrette and really yummy. The soup, which is a bit of a small portion, is delicious but passable — it’s not going to knock your socks off, but that’s OK. Pasta here is homemade — don’t go there and not order it. It’s expensive, but worth it. It’s perfectly al dente and clings to sauce. The restaurant also has a whole-wheat option if you are willing to pay a few dollars more. The restaurant serves a small selection of beer and wine. I find the selection to be a bit amateur, and the prices a bit high, so I usually don’t splurge on wine when I go. The restaurant also offers«half portions» on some entrees. This is a good option if you don’t feel like rolling out of the restaurant feeling overstuffed, and save a few bucks, but I find the difference in portion size to be a bit negligible most of the time when I opt for the half portion. Just pay more and take the leftovers home with you! There are plenty of good options for children here as well. There are a few small reasons I did not give this restaurant a better rating. For starters, it’s a small place that’s easy to miss if you’re driving down busy Lorain Rd. The tiny parking lot can be very tricky on a busy night. I have a few other concerns about the facilities. Although it’s very cheerfully decorated with Italian-themed artwork, the restaurant seems to have a climate control problem, as it’s hot in the summer and cold in the winter. The restrooms can be a bit odorific at times, making for an unappetizing experience. The small dining area can be loud during peak, busy times. Dominic’s Santos also seems to play Michael Buble on a loop — blech. Service is inconsistent. Our first experience was fantastic, as we had a very attentive server who welcomed us and introduced us to the restaurant’s most popular dishes. There have been other times, however, where service was slow(during non-peak times) or negligent(you definitely need regular beverage refills for that vodka sauce!). I have been troubled by other inconsistencies, like pasta that was cooked too long, the restaurant giving me a different kind of pasta from what I ordered, and finally, one occasion where my husband requested the chicken Francese to be placed atop plain pasta, without marinara sauce — and the server said it would be a $ 3 charge. Why would you charge a patron more for less? My husband had ordered it that way before without any extra charge. Odd. Portion sizes have also varied on different visits. If I leave hungry, something’s up, in other words. The bread is great when it is soft and fresh, but not so great when it is dry and stale; you never know what you’re going to get on any given visit. We’ve ordered carryout on a few occasions, and it’s been both stellar(everything well-packed with a generous amount of bread and butter) and disappointing(soup/salad omitted from the order). If the restaurant addressed some of these issues, it would probably be my go-to place when I’m feenin’ for some Italian. But I’ll forgive and forget as soon as a bowl of vodka sauce is placed in front of me.
